Lost my daddy in july 1991 to lung cancer. Spoke to him in the hospital on a saturday afternoon, he went into a coma the next day and passed away three days later. The one thing that I can't recollect to this day is what our last conversation was about!!He owned/worked on tractor/trailers until he retired as I do for a living today and I guess that was the topic. The Dr. let me stay way past the half hour time limit that day and I'll be forever grateful to him for that! If he could see what the big 18 wheelers are today he'd flip out and say some strong words about too much modern stuff and I'd agree! My older sister has a picture of him sitting on my 9N in January 1940 and they had just bought it on December 22nd,1939. Had shiny paint!
